Job Title : Java Architect
Job Location: Tampa, Florida, United States(onsite)
Experience : 10 years
Job Duration : 6 Months
Study Level : Bachelor's Degree
Skill Required :DE-Web Foundation, Core Java Foundation.
Primary Skill : Java, Spring Boot, Core Java
Job Description :
• Hands-on practical experience in system design, application development, testing, and operational stability.
• Proficient in coding in one or more languages.
• Experience in developing, debugging, and maintaining code in a large corporate environment with one or more modern programming languages and database querying languages.
• Overall knowledge of the Software Development Life Cycle.
• Solid understanding of agile methodologies such as CI/CD, Application Resiliency, and Security.
• Demonstrated knowledge of software applications and technical processes within a technical discipline (e.g., cloud, artificial intelligence, machine learning, mobile, etc.).
• Core Java (version 17 or higher) development experience with Spring-boot or similar frameworks.
• Experience in developing cloud-native applications with demonstrated implementation of ReSTful microservices, containers, resilient and scalable platforms.
• Hands-on experience with Docker, Kubernetes or related container platform.
• Experience with Cloud native container orchestrator tools and software deployment ideally with Kubernetes.
• Experience with message bus technologies such as Kafka.
• Experience with batch processing architecture and use of spring-batch or equivalent tool.
• Experience with two or more database technologies like Oracle, Postgres or in memory DB/cache.
• Experience working on high throughput mission critical high performance STP platforms.
• Experience in Test Driven Development using JUnit, Mockito or similar.
• Design, develop, test, and maintain Java-based applications.
• Collaborate with cross-functional teams to define, design, and deliver new features.
• Develop and optimize PL/SQL scripts, stored procedures, functions, triggers, and packages.
• Perform database tuning and performance monitoring.
• Analyze existing systems and enhance them as per business requirements.
• Core Java (version 17 or higher).
• Oracle, Postgres or in memory DB/cache.
• Docker, Kubernetes or related container platform.
• ReSTful microservices.
• Kafka, React, AWS, DevOps, Generative AI and Agentic AI technologies.